Deactivate objects when far from player
When I played the game all the chess pieces where showing up at the same time so I needed to find some way to make them appear gradually as the player gets closer to them.
this script requires referencing with Player, the Pawn and distance. It checks if player is in range with a pawn in a certain distance, it will activate the pawn in the scene, or else the rest will remain hidden. This function will loop for each pawn in this distance.

Platform Movement
the path is developed in 3 levels. to go one level to another there is a big step that you can not climb up, therefore I made these moving platform that work as lifts because can transfer the player up and down just by stepping on it. Link for the tutorial I followed:

Ball spawining & VR interaction
this is the main interaction in VR with the player. the player has to pick up the ball and throw it againt the king to decrease his health and destroy it in the end. Had some technical issues:
- balls where not colliding with the king and decreasing his health
- balls where spawning continuously without getting destroyed.

as it can be seen from the video it is spawining more than 3 balls per time. I decided to keep it like this because trying in VR is easier to pick up the balls since the playre has more possibilities and it also fits the crazy aesthetics.

- Balls are tagged “Ball” when spawned, but when picked up by the player it changes in to deadly to decrease the king health.

Checkmate VR is a VR survival game that challenges the player to survive a long distorted chessboard full of enemies, which are the basic chess pieces jumping around and moving following chess rules. The final step is to do checkmate by trowing this spiky ball to the King do decrease his health, but at the same time there is the Queen that tries her best to get in the player way.
It is an Immersive Virtual Reality game, where the player can experience a surreal world, which only VR can give, where our usual human point of view is rescaled and everything around us that in real life we are used to see small and innocent is huge and dangerous. I wanted to give another meaning to simple objects of our day to day life creating a whole new journey in this inspired Alice in Wonderland World.
